APX803L05-50SA-7 belongs to the category of voltage supervisors.
It is primarily used for monitoring and controlling the voltage levels in electronic circuits.
The APX803L05-50SA-7 comes in a small SOT-23-5 package.
The essence of APX803L05-50SA-7 lies in its ability to provide accurate voltage monitoring and reset functions in various electronic applications.

The APX803L05-50SA-7 operates by comparing the input voltage with the threshold voltage. When the input voltage falls below the threshold, the device triggers a reset signal. This signal remains active until the input voltage rises above the threshold again.

Q: What is APX803L05-50SA-7? A: APX803L05-50SA-7 is a voltage detector IC (integrated circuit) that monitors the power supply voltage and provides a reset signal when the voltage drops below a specified threshold.
Q: What is the operating voltage range of APX803L05-50SA-7? A: The operating voltage range of APX803L05-50SA-7 is typically between 0.8V and 5.5V.
Q: What is the purpose of using APX803L05-50SA-7 in a technical solution? A: APX803L05-50SA-7 is commonly used to monitor the power supply voltage in various electronic devices and systems, ensuring proper operation and preventing data corruption or damage due to low voltage conditions.
Q: How does APX803L05-50SA-7 provide a reset signal? A: When the power supply voltage drops below the specified threshold, APX803L05-50SA-7 asserts the reset signal, which can be used to reset microcontrollers, CPUs, or other digital circuits.
Q: What is the typical reset threshold voltage of APX803L05-50SA-7? A: The typical reset threshold voltage of APX803L05-50SA-7 is 4.63V.
Q: Can the reset threshold voltage be adjusted in APX803L05-50SA-7? A: No, the reset threshold voltage of APX803L05-50SA-7 is fixed and cannot be adjusted.
Q: What is the maximum supply current of APX803L05-50SA-7? A: The maximum supply current of APX803L05-50SA-7 is typically 1µA (microampere).
Q: Is APX803L05-50SA-7 suitable for battery-powered applications? A: Yes, APX803L05-50SA-7 is suitable for battery-powered applications due to its low supply current and wide operating voltage range.
Q: Does APX803L05-50SA-7 have any built-in delay before asserting the reset signal? A: Yes, APX803L05-50SA-7 has a built-in delay of approximately 200ms (milliseconds) to ensure stable power supply before asserting the reset signal.
